Closeup picture of a tick that needs tick prevention and control servicesTicks are tiny insects that can spread devastating illnesses, including Lyme disease. According to the Center for Disease Control, approximately 30,000 cases of Lyme are reported each year. And that doesn’t even account for those who go undiagnosed. Since the disease is frequently misdiagnosed, that number likely only reflects a fraction of the true cases. That’s a frightening fact. But as a Pottstown, PA area homeowner, there are steps you can take in terms of tick prevention. Here are just a few to consider:

Clean up your lawn. Ticks like to hide in leaf and wood piles. That’s why it’s important to make sure your lawn is well maintained. Simply by keeping your grass trimmed, trees and shrubs neat, and your yard cleaned up, you’ll go a long way in removing favorable conditions for ticks.

Create barriers for deer and ticks. Deer are beautiful to look at, but they’re carriers of ticks, which is why you don’t want them in your lawn. You can fence in your entire lawn. Or, if that’s cost-prohibitive, consider fencing in the areas where you and your family spend most of your time. You can also purchase inexpensive deer repellant to deter deer from entering your lawn.

As tick prevention experts in the Pottstown area, we know another way to prevent ticks from getting into your lawn is to create a barrier of rocks or mulch that separates your property from the woods. This blockade will stop ticks from wandering into your lawn.

Invest in tick-repelling plants for your yard. There are actually certain plants that naturally repel ticks. For instance, lavender, garlic, and certain types of chrysanthemum are known to deter ticks. Plant those in areas where you and your family congregate.

Check pets before bringing them inside. Ticks don’t just like humans, they like any warm-blooded animal. So before you bring Fido inside, check his coat for ticks. Ticks can often hitch a ride on pets and end up in the home.
